Friction resists movement, and M (mu) is the friction coefficient. The force of friction is directly related to mu, so a smaller mu causes the force of friction to be smaller. A large friction force is keeping the white cat from moving on the roof, so the white cat has a large mu. The brown cat has a small mu because it is sliding on the roof, so there is a small friction force which is why the brown cat falls first.
